Description: How can a utility’s rate design and policies around collections promote affordability? In this 1-hour webinar, join EFCN experts to learn about how different rate structures impact customers, how to set rate structures equitably, and how utility policies can help customers who have a hard time paying bills.

Presenter: Elsemarie Mullins, Project Director, Environmental Finance Center at the University of North Carolina

Cost: Complimentary.

Who Should Attend:

  • Managers, owners, and operators of water systems serving less than 10,000 people
  • Decision-makers for water utilities, including mayors, finance officers, utility managers, public works directors, city councilors, board members, tribal council members, and clerks
  • Consultants and technical assistance providers serving water systems
